MJB42CT4G General Purpose and Low VCE(sat) Transistors by ON Semiconductor

6.0 A, 100 V PNP Bipolar Power Transistor


MJB42C is a 100 V PNP bipolar Complementary power transistor. The complementary NPN is MJB41C.

Features

Lead Formed for Surface Mount Applications in Plastic Sleeves (No Suffix)
Lead Formed Version in 16 mm Tape & Reel ("T4" Suffix)
Electrically the Same as TIP41 and T1P42 Series
NJV Prefix for Automotive and Other Applications Requiring Unique Site and Control Change Requirements; AEC-Q101 Qualified and PPAP Capable
Pb-Free Packages are Available

Specifications

Description MJB42C
Compliance Pb-free Halide free
Polarity PNP
Type General Purpose
VCE(sat) Max (V) 1.5
IC Cont. (A) 6
VCEO Min (V) 100
VCBO (V) 100
VEBO (V) 5
VBE(sat) (V) -
VBE(on) (V) 2
hFE Min 15
hFE Max 75
fT Min (MHz) 3
PTM Max (W) 65
Package Type D2PAK-3 / TO-263-2
